Используя igraph, как заставить кривизну, когда стрелки указывают в противоположных направлениях

autocurve.edges проделывает потрясающую работу по изгибу краев на графиках igraph, чтобы они не перекрывались, когда они указывают в одном направлении. Однако, когда они указывают в противоположных направлениях, кривизна не применяется.

d <- data.frame(start=c("a","a","b","c"),end=c("b","b","c","b"))


graph <- graph.data.frame(d, directed=T)

plot(graph,
     vertex.color="white")

Вопрос для стрелок между b и c (или c и b).

Кроме указания кривизны вручную, есть предложения?

Ответы на вопрос(1)

Ваш ответ на вопрос